Overview of Dr. Michael Kuhn, MD

Dr. Michael Kuhn, MD is an Orthopedic Surgery Specialist in Middletown, CT. Dr. Kuhn, completed a fellowship at New England Baptist Hospital. Patients rated Dr. Kuhn an average 4.9 star rating.

Dr. Kuhn works at Practice in Middletown, CT with other offices in Westbrook, CT and Marlborough, CT. They frequently treat conditions like Lateral Epicondylitis and Joint Pain along with other conditions at varying frequencies. They are accepting new patients and accept Aetna, Anthem and Blue Cross Blue Shield as well as other major insurance plans.     What’s a board certification and why is it important that my provider has one?

    A board certification represents a provider’s dedication to ongoing training in one or more specialties, including the completion of intensive exams. While not all specialties have board certifications, if your provider does have one they’ve taken the extra step to master their specialty and to keep up with the latest advancements in their field.
